Definition and Importance

Heart Words are high-frequency, irregular words that do not follow standard phonetic rules, making them essential for memorization to build reading fluency. These words, often derived from Fry or Dolch lists, are critical because they appear frequently in texts but cannot be decoded using typical phonics skills. Unlike decodable words, Heart Words require direct instruction and repetition for mastery. They are categorized into permanent and temporary types, with permanent Heart Words being universally irregular and temporary ones containing patterns students haven’t yet learned. The importance of Heart Words lies in their role in improving reading speed, comprehension, and overall literacy skills. By mastering these words, students gain confidence and efficiency in reading, laying a strong foundation for academic success. Educators and parents emphasize their significance, as they are integral to early literacy development and long-term reading proficiency.

Using Flashcards

Flashcards are an effective tool for teaching Heart Words, providing a visual and hands-on approach to memorization. Each card typically features a word on one side and its meaning or pronunciation guide on the other. The irregular parts of the words are often highlighted with hearts or special markers to draw attention to unconventional spelling patterns. Teachers and parents can use pre-made Heart Word Flashcards available in PDF format, which are organized by grade levels and vowel sounds. These flashcards are designed to make learning engaging and systematic. Regular practice with flashcards helps students build familiarity and confidence with high-frequency words they need to recognize instantly. The portability of flashcards also allows for practice anywhere, reinforcing learning in a fun and accessible way. This method is particularly effective for visual learners and those who benefit from repetitive, structured practice.

Incorporating Games

Incorporating games into Heart Words instruction makes learning engaging and fun. One effective game is Heart Word Bingo, where students match words from their lists to corresponding squares on a bingo card. Another popular activity is Memory Match, where students pair words from a set of face-down cards. Teachers can also use Heart Word Scavenger Hunts, hiding words around the classroom for students to find and read aloud. Digital games, such as online matching and sorting activities, provide interactive practice. Additionally, Heart Word Charades encourages students to act out words for their peers to guess, fostering teamwork and creativity. These games not only enhance recognition and retention but also make the learning process enjoyable. By integrating playful competition and collaboration, educators can help students master their Heart Words in a dynamic and memorable way.
